Driveway slope repair services focus on fixing issues related to uneven or improperly graded driveways. Over time, natural settling, soil erosion, or poor initial construction can cause a driveway to develop dips, slopes, or uneven surfaces. Service providers use various techniques to restore proper drainage and levelness, which may involve grading, adding new layers of material, or installing retaining features. Properly repaired slopes help ensure that water flows away from the property and prevent further deterioration of the driveway surface.
These services are essential for addressing common problems such as pooling water, cracks, ruts, and shifting pavement. When a driveway’s slope is off, water can collect and cause damage, leading to cracks or potholes. An uneven driveway also presents safety hazards, especially in icy or wet conditions, making it difficult for vehicles to traverse smoothly. Repairing the slope can improve the driveway’s durability, reduce maintenance needs, and enhance overall safety and appearance.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Slope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hickory,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way slope fixes in Hickory range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ially when only a small section needs adjustment or patching.
Moderate Repairs - More involved slope corrections or partial resurfacing us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ects often include regrading or minor reinforcement work handled by local contractors.
Full Driveway Resurfacing - Complete slope repairs or resurfacing of an entire driveway can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Larger projects are less common but necessary for significant drainage or structural issues.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ire driveway due to severe slope problems typically costs $4,000 to $8,000 or more. These extensive projects are less frequent but handled by experienced local service providers when need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es driveway slopes to become uneven? Driveway slopes can become uneven due to soil erosion, poor initial grading, or shifting ground caused by weather conditions in Hickory, NC.
How do professionals repair driveway slope issues? Local contractors typically assess the slope, remove damaged material, and regrade or add new material to restore proper drainage and stability.
Can driveway slope repair prevent future problems? Yes, proper repair and drainage solutions can help prevent further settling or cracking caused by slope issues.
What signs indicate driveway slope repair might be needed? Visible cracking, pooling water, or noticeable unevenness are common signs that driveway slope repair could be necessary.
Are there different methods for repairing driveway slopes? Yes, options include regrading, adding retaining walls, or installing drainage systems, depending on the specific slope problem.
